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[advAjax] Odświeżanie strony
Forum PHP.pl > Forum > XML, AJAX > AJAX
Kayne
Witam

Wiem, że to może być banalny problem ale jednak...


Mam chat złożony z dwóch plików - chat.php i chatmsg.php. chat.php tworzy iframe i w tym iframie jest ładowany chatmsg.php.

chat.php posiada też funckję do dodawania nowych wiadomości.

Moje pytanie brzmi - jak odświeżać iframe bez ciągłego ładowania strony w nim? Oraz jak można (opcjonalnie) za pomocą Ajaxa wykonywać formularz z chat.php bez konieczności przeładowywania całej strony (chat.php + iframe z chatmsg.php).


Mam nadzieję, że jasno się wyraziłem - w razie czego piszcie a wyjaśnię dokładniej.
Vogel
AJAX ni ma nic do odswiezania. AJAX tylko POBIERA/WYSYLA dane i ew inicjuje kolejne funkcje/skrypty. strone odsiwezasz przy pomocy JS (a konkretnie document.getElementById(...).innerHTML i wypelniasz element na stronie). czestotliwosc odswiezania to tez JS.
Kayne
No ok, to teraz prosiłbyn o kod w JS ponieważ - w JS nigdy jeszcze nie programowałem, tylko php.

Oraz jeśli łaska prosiłbym o kod, dzięki któremu mogę wysłać z formularza (submit i text) i zeby wykonał się kod z chat.php bez koniecznosci przeładowania strony. Niestety w JS i Ajax jestem kompletnym noobem sad.gif
Vogel
Anakin.us - przyklady
generalnie przyjzyj sie "Ładowanie danych do trzech warstw" i to powinno styknac.
Kayne
No dobra, dugo z tym walczyłem (do 4 w nocy :/ ) i mi się udało :-)
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.